The Sims 2: Apartment Pets is the upcoming sequel to the Sims 2 Pet expansion. We expected to hate it. I mean, you would, wouldn't you, with a title that couldn't scream The Sims 2: Cash In any more. But hey, we're grown ups so we can admit when we're wrong. The Sims 2: Apartment Pets is looking pretty entertaining and from our play of it, we're impressed. You build you own pet spa up, and basically play The Sims but with pets. You dress them up in crazy outfits and see to their every need. For some people, pets are part of
the family but for others they're a
smelly and dirty hindrance on
everyday life. Thankfully, for those of
you that fall into the latter camp, EA is
releasing a fully fledged sequel to 2006's
Sims 2 ‘Pets' expansion pack, in which
it's possible to own loads of different
animals without having to worry about
cleaning up all that mess.
The basic premise doesn't differ too
drastically from the tried-and-tested Sims
template. You're tasked with running a
pet spa, and as your business grows then
so too does the amount of stuff you can
purchase for your apartment. Here the
game is rooted in traditional Sims
territory as you can choose from a large
number of domestic appliances.
Unsurprisingly, you can also fill your living
space with all sorts of animals, although
the caveat is that you can only own one
of each type at any given time.
